HEALTHY HOMES BAROMETER 2015

by Michael K. Rasmussen, VELUX Group

Today, we are certain that our homes have a huge impact on our health and wellbeing. We live 90 % of our lives inside buildings. Yet, an estimated 80 million Europeans live in homes that suffer from damp, which almost doubles the risk of developing asthma. Indoor air quality is a major health concern for Europe.

EARTH HOUR ON SATURDAY 28 MARCH 2015 AT 20:30

by Nicolas Roy, VELUX Group

Earth Hour started in 2007 as a lights-off event to raise awareness about climate change. It has grown to engage more than 162 countries and territories worldwide. This year #EarthHour is on Saturday, 28 March 2015 at 8:30 pm local time.

SOLAR ECLIPSE, SUPERMOON AND SPRING EQUINOX ON 20 MARCH 2015

by Nicolas Roy, VELUX Group

On this Friday, not only will the spring equinox be occuring once again, but we will also have the chance to experience a solar eclipse and the third supermoon this year.

PLENTY OF DAYLIGHT WITHOUT OVERHEATING

by Peter Foldbjerg and Nicolas Roy, VELUX Group

Will high levels of daylight in a home automatically lead to overheating? Not necessarily. With the right preventive measures, we have demonstrated that it is possible to deliver high amount of daylight without having overheating problems, and that windows actually play a key role in keeping a comfortable indoor environment during summer time.
